1Brutus.
2I heard him sweare,
3Were he to stand for Consull, neuer would he
4Appeare i'th'Market place, nor on him put
5The Naples Vesture of Humilitie,
6Nor shewing (as the manner is) his Wounds
7Toth' People, begge their stinking Breaths.
